Terminals Of Ecu

  1. CHECK MAIN BODY ECU RH (COWL SIDE J/B RH) 
    1. Disconnect the main body ECU RH (cowl side J/B RH) connectors.

    2. Measure the resistance and voltage of the wire harness side connectors.
      WIRING COLOR TERMINAL DESCRIPTION (1 OF 4)

      Symbols (Terminal No.) Wiring Color Terminal Description Condition Specified Condition
      PCTY (J75-23) - Body ground B - Body ground Passenger side courtesy light switch input Passenger side door CLOSED (OFF) --> OPEN (ON) 10 kΩ or higher --> Below 1 Ω
      LGCY (J75-25) - Body ground L - Body ground Luggage compartment door courtesy light switch input Luggage compartment door CLOSED (OFF) --> OPEN (ON) 10 kΩ or higher --> Below 1 Ω
      DCTY (P1-14) - Body ground W - Body ground Driver side door courtesy light switch input Driver side door CLOSED (OFF) --> OPEN (ON) 10 kΩ or higher --> Below 1 Ω
      RCTY (P1-16) - Body ground O - Body ground Rear courtesy light switch RH input Rear door RH CLOSED (OFF) --> OPEN (ON) 10 kΩ or higher --> Below 1 Ω
      GND2 (RA-11) - Body ground BR - Body ground Ground Always Below 1 Ω
      LCTY (RA-11) - Body ground R - Body ground Rear courtesy light switch LH input Rear door LH CLOSED (OFF) --> OPEN (ON) 10 kΩ or higher --> Below 1 Ω
      ALTB (RM-1) - Body ground B - Body ground +B (power generator system) power supply Always 10 to 14 V
      GND2 (RD-7) - Body ground W-B - Body ground Ground Always Below 1 Ω
      BECU (RK-5) - Body ground G-R - Body ground +B power supply Always 10 to 14 V
      ACC (RM-1) - Body ground B - Body ground Ignition power supply (ACC signal) Engine switch on (ACC) --> off 10 to 14 V --> Below 1 V
      IG (RM-1) - Body ground B - Body ground Ignition power supply (IG signal) Engine switch on (ACC) --> off 10 to 14 V --> Below 1 V
      BATB (RN-1) - Body ground R - Body ground +B (power battery system) power supply Always 10 to 14 V

      If the result is not as specified, there may be a malfunction on the wire harness side.

    3. Reconnect the main body ECU RH (cowl side J/B RH) connectors.
    4. Measure the resistance and voltage of the wire harness side connectors.
    WIRING COLOR TERMINAL DESCRIPTION (2 OF 4)

    Symbols (Terminal No.) Wiring Color Terminal Description Condition Specified Condition
    SH (A36-1) - Body ground W- Body ground Security horn drive Answer back security horn is not sounding --> Sounding Below 1 V --> 10 to 14 V
    BZR (A36-2) - Body ground G - Body ground Wireless door lock buzzer Wireless door lock buzzer OFF --> ON 0 V --> Pulse generation
    TR+ (J74-1) - Body ground P - Body ground Luggage compartment door opener motor input Luggage compartment door CLOSED (LOCKED) --> OPEN (UNLOCKED) Below 1 V --> 10 to 14 V
    HAZ (J74-2) - Body ground Y - Body ground Turn signal flasher relay signal Any transmitter switch is pressed --> not pressed Below 1 V --> 10 to 14 V
  2. CHECK CERTIFICATION ECU ASSEMBLY

    1. Disconnect the P33 ECU connector.
    2. Measure the voltage and resistance of the wire harness side connector.
      WIRING COLOR TERMINAL DESCRIPTION (3 OF 4)

      Symbols (Terminal No.) Wiring Color Terminal Description Condition Specified Condition
      +B1 (P33-1) - E (P33-17) L - W-B Battery power supply Always 10 to 14 V
      E (P33-17) - Body ground W-B - Body ground Ground Always Below 1 Ω
      IG (P33-18) - E (P33-17) B - W-B IG power supply Engine switch on (IG) 10 to 14 V
      IG (P33-18) - E (P33-17) B - W-B IG power supply Engine switch off Below 1 V

      If the result is not as specified, there may be a malfunction on the wire harness side.

    3. Reconnect the P33 ECU connector.
    4. Measure the voltage of the connector.
    WIRING COLOR TERMINAL DESCRIPTION (4 OF 4)

    Symbols (Terminal No.) Wiring Color Terminal Description Condition Specified Condition
    RC0 (P33-29) - E (P33-17) Y - W-B Door control receiver power supply Engine switch off, all doors closed and transmitter switch not pressed Below 1 V
    RC0 (P33-29) - E (P33-17) Y - W-B Door control receiver power supply Engine switch off, all doors closed and transmitter switch pressed 4.6 to 5.4 V
    RDA (P33-38) - E (P33-17) R - W-B Door control receiver output signal Engine switch off, all doors closed and transmitter switch not pressed 10 to 14 V
    RDA (P33-38) - E (P33-17) R - W-B Door control receiver output signal Engine switch off, all doors closed and transmitter switch pressed Pulse generation
